tcp/mips: Change TCG_AREG0 (fp -> s0)
Register fp (frame pointer) is a bad choice for compilationswithout optimisation, because the compiler makes heavy useof this register (so the resulting code crashes).
Register s0 had been used for TCG_AREG1 in earlier releases,...
Use correct cflags for kvm-kmod when cross compiling
Using $pkgconfig instead of pkg-config will use${cross_prefix}pkg-config if that is available.
This fix is needed for cross compilations withoutmodified PATH. Without the fix, PATH must be modifiedto find the cross pkg-config before the native...
linux-user: do_shmdt(): Fix page_set_flags's 2nd arg.
2nd arg of page_set_flags() should be start+size, but size.
Signed-off-by: Takashi YOSHII <takasi-y@ops.dti.ne.jp>Acked-by: Richard Henderson <rth@twiddle.net>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>
vhost.c: include <linux/vhost.h> last
So the userspace headers define KERNEL_STRICT_NAMES and there's noconflict on type definition for older kernels.
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>Acked-by: Michael S. Tsirkin <mst@redhat.com>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>
vhost-net: disable mergeable buffers
vhost in current kernels doesn't support mergeable buffers.Disable this feature if vhost is enabled, until suchsupport is implemented.
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>
vhost: fix features ack
vhost driver in qemu didn't ack features, and this happensto work because we don't really require any features. However,it's better not to rely on this. This patch passes features tovhost as guest acks them.
Signed-off-by: David L Stevens <dlstevens@us.ibm.com>...
r2d: always enable IDE and flash
IDE and flash are part of the R2D board, and can't be removed. Emulatethem even if there is no hard-drive plugged to the IDE or if the flashcontent is empty.
sh_pci: fix memory and I/O access
Since commit 8da3ff180974732fc4272cb4433fef85c1822961 ("MMIO callbackinterface changes"), the addresses passed to the I/O functions are anoffset to the start of the area. As a consequence, there is no need tocorrect the address using the value of IOBR. This make possible the use...
Fix build when configured with --enable-io-thread
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
Cleanup dead code
This patch removes some dead code in exec.c
Signed-off-by: Jun Koi <junkoi2004@gmail.com>Signed-off-by: Blue Swirl <blauwirbel@gmail.com>
View all revisions | View revisions
Also available in: Atom